This course focuses specifically on the development process for creating web-based materials for online courses. This course also provides instruction and experience in planning and developing a website and implementing it on a server. In the process, you will learn the basics of HTML, produce a simple website, manipulate simple graphics, develop a cascading stylesheet, create multimedia objects, and use FTP to interact with a server. These experiences and skills provide a sufficient background to develop basic educational web-based materials, and to work with a development team to produce sophisticated educational or training systems.
